1. Welcome to Cobbs Hill

Nestled in the heart of Rochester's vibrant southeast side, Cobbs Hill is a picturesque and highly sought-after neighborhood known for its stunning natural beauty and strong community spirit. The area is famously centered around Cobbs Hill Park, a 109-acre green space offering panoramic views of the Rochester skyline, serene walking trails, and a beloved reservoir. This blend of urban accessibility and natural retreat defines the character of the community.

The neighborhood features a charming mix of architectural styles, from classic early 20th-century American Foursquares and Craftsmans to elegant Tudors and Colonials, all set on tree-lined streets. Its proximity to the Park Avenue and Monroe Avenue entertainment districts means residents enjoy a perfect balance of quiet residential living and easy access to some of the city's best dining, shopping, and cultural amenities.

3. Real Estate Market

Cobbs Hill represents one of Rochester's most stable and desirable real estate markets. The median home value here is approximately $221,700, which is notably above the city-wide average, reflecting the area's popularity and the quality of its housing stock. Homes are in high demand, often leading to competitive bidding situations. The architecture is predominantly solid, early-to-mid-20th century construction, with many homes featuring unique character details, mature landscaping, and spacious lots.

The strong housing market is supported by the neighborhood's demographics, including a median household income of around $78,378. This economic stability contributes to well-maintained properties and a high rate of homeownership. 4. Schools & Education

Cobbs Hill is served by the Rochester City School District, with many families in the neighborhood opting for School No. 10, a community-focused elementary school. The area is also in close proximity to several highly-regarded private and charter school options, including the Allendale Columbia School and the Harley School, providing families with a variety of educational choices to fit their needs.

5. Transportation & Connectivity

Connectivity is a key advantage of living in Cobbs Hill. The neighborhood is seamlessly integrated into Rochester's road network, with easy access to Interstate 490, providing a quick 10-minute drive to downtown Rochester, the Strong Museum of Play, and Rochester General Hospital. Major employment centers, including the University of Rochester medical campus and downtown corporate offices, are conveniently commutable.

For those who prefer alternative transportation, the area is highly walkable and bikeable, with dedicated lanes and paths connecting to the park and commercial districts. The Regional Transit Service (RTS) provides reliable bus lines along major thoroughfares like Monroe and Park Avenues, connecting residents to the entire metro area. The Rochester International Airport is also just a 15-minute drive away, simplifying travel.
